Перенос базы из SQL в Access и обратно - Raymond Patyupin - MCSE, MCSA, MCITP, MCTS, MCP, RHCSA, RHCT.

Опубликовано 24.07.2017 | Автор:

Ошибка подключения к базе 7.7 SQL

Пользовательский интерфейс в Dreamweaver СС и более поздних версиях стал проще. В результате этого некоторые функции, описанные в этой статье, могут отсутствовать в Dreamweaver CC и более поздних версиях.

Odbc sql server driver не удается открыть базу

Одной из наиболее частых проблем являются недостаточные разрешения для папок или файлов. Если база данных расположена на компьютере под управлением Windows или Windows XP и при попытке просмотра динамической страницы в веб-браузере или интерактивном представлении появляется сообщение об ошибке, то возможной причиной может быть проблема с разрешениями.

Учетная запись Windows, с помощью которой пользователь пытается войти в базу данных, не имеет достаточных прав. Кроме того, чтобы разрешить запись в базу данных, также нужно настроить определенные разрешения для папки, содержащей эту базу данных. Этот шаг нужно выполнить даже в том случае, если общий ресурс расположен на локальном веб-сервере.

Если база данных копируется из другого расположения, она может не унаследовать разрешения от папки назначения, поэтому потребуется вручную изменить разрешения для этой базы данных. Этот шаг применим только в том случае, если используется файловая система NTFS.

Odbc sql server driver не удается открыть базу

Для дополнительной безопасности можно отключить разрешение на чтение для веб-папки, содержащей базу данных. То есть просмотр содержимого этой папки будет запрещен, но доступ к базе данных для веб-страниц по-прежнему будет открыт. Дополнительные сведения о разрешениях для учетной записи IUSR и веб-сервера см. Общие сведения об анонимной проверке подлинности и учетной записи IUSR находятся по адресу: Подробнее о настройке разрешений веб-сервера IIS см. Подобные сообщения об ошибках могут появляться во время запроса динамической страницы с сервера, если сервер IIS Internet Information Server используется с базой данных, разработанной корпорацией Майкрософт, например Access или SQL Server.

Корпорация Adobe не предоставляет техническую поддержку для программных продуктов сторонних разработчиков, например для Microsoft Windows и сервера IIS. Если приведенная в данной главе информация не помогла устранить проблему, обратитесь в службу технической поддержки Майкрософт или посетите веб-сайт технической поддержки Майкрософт по адресу: Дополнительные сведения об ошибках см. Эта ошибка возникает при попытке просмотра динамической страницы в веб-браузере или интерактивном представлении.

Текст сообщения может отличаться в зависимости от используемой базы данных и веб-сервера. К вариантам этого сообщения об ошибке относятся следующие. Странице не удается найти имя DSN. Убедитесь, что DSN было создано и на веб-сервере, и на локальном компьютере. Возможно, имя DSN задано как DSN пользователя, а не DSN системы. Удалите DSN пользователя и создайте вместо него DSN системы. Если этого не сделать, дублирующиеся имена DSN вызовут новую ошибку ODBC.

Не могу подключиться к sql базе

Если используется приложение Microsoft Access, файл базы данных MDB-файл может быть заблокирован. Причина блокирования может заключаться в том, что DSN с другим именем уже использует базу данных. Откройте проводник Windows , в папке, в которой расположен файл базы данных MDB-файл , найдите файл блокировки LDB-файл и удалите его.

Если другое имя DSN указывает на один и тот же файл базы данных, удалите это имя, чтобы избежать ошибок в дальнейшем. Перезагрузите компьютер после внесения изменений. Эта ошибка возникает при использовании базы данных Microsoft Access и попытке просмотра динамической страницы в веб-браузере или интерактивном представлении. Еще один вариант текста этого сообщения об ошибке: Далее перечислены несколько конкретных причин и способов решения. Возможно, учетная запись, используемая сервером IIS как правило, это учетная запись IUSR , не имеет нужных разрешений Windows для доступа к файловой базе данных или папке, содержащей эту базу данных.

Проверьте разрешения учетной записи IIS IUSR в диспетчере пользователей. Пользователь может не иметь разрешения на создание или удаление временных файлов. Проверьте разрешения для файла и папки. Убедитесь в наличии разрешения на создание или удаление временных файлов. В Windows может потребоваться изменить значение времени ожидания для DSN базы данных Access. Эта ошибка возникает при использовании сервера Microsoft SQL Server и попытке просмотра динамической страницы в веб-браузере или интерактивном представлении. Эта ошибка создается сервером SQL Server, если он не принимает либо не распознает учетную запись или введенный пароль если используется стандартная защита , или же если учетная запись Windows не соответствует учетной записи SQL если используется встроенная система безопасности.

Если используется стандартная защита, причиной ошибки может быть неправильные имя учетной записи и пароль. Имена DSN не хранят имена и пароли пользователей. Если используется встроенная система безопасности, проверьте учетную запись Windows, обращающуюся к странице, и найдите соответствующую ей учетную запись SQL при наличии. Сервер SQL Server не допускает использование нижних подчеркиваний в именах учетных записей SQL. Учетную запись, в которой использовано нижнее подчеркивание, нужно сопоставлять с именем учетной записи на сервере SQL, в котором нижнее подчеркивание не используется.

Разрешения для доступа к папке, содержащей базу данных, слишком ограничены.

Odbc sql server driver не удается открыть базу

Для обновления базы данных требуется, чтобы она располагалась в каталоге wwwroot. В противном случае будут доступны только просмотр и поиск данных, но не их обновление. Набор записей основан на необновляемом запросе. Хорошими примерами необновляемых запросов в базе данных являются соединения. Преобразуйте необновляемые запросы в обновляемые.

Дополнительные сведения об этой ошибке см. Microsoft Access имеет строгую типизацию данных, которая устанавливает четкий набор правил для соответствующих значений столбцов.

Общие сведения о подключении к данным и их импорте

Данная ошибка возникает в том случае, если столбец, указанный в запросе SQL, отсутствует в таблице базы данных. Проверьте имена столбцов в таблице базы данных на соответствие столбцам, указанным в запросе SQL. Зачастую причиной этой ошибки является опечатка. Данная ошибка может возникать при попытке вставить запись в поле базы данных, в имени которого содержится вопросительный знак? Для некоторых обработчиков баз данных, включая Microsoft Access, вопросительный знак является специальным символом, поэтому его нельзя использовать в именах таблиц баз данных и в именах полей.

Откройте систему базы данных и удалите вопросительный знак? Как правило, эта ошибка появляется вследствие одной или нескольких описанных ниже проблем с именами полей, объектов или переменных в базе данных. В качестве имени использовано зарезервированное слово. Большинство баз данных имеют набор зарезервированных слов. Подобная ошибка также может возникать, если для объекта в базе данных была определена маска ввода, но вставленные данные не соответствуют этой маске. Помимо этого, исключите пробелы и специальные символы.

Списки зарезервированных слов для наиболее распространенных систем баз данных см. Базе данных не удается обработать операцию обновления или вставки, которую пытается выполнить серверное поведение. Серверное поведение пытается обновить поле автонумерации в таблице базы данных или вставить запись в это поле. Так как поля автонумерации заполняются автоматически самой системой базы данных, внешние попытки заполнить эти поля значениями приводят к ошибкам. Серверное поведение обновляет или вставляет данные неправильного типа в поле базы данных. Данная проблема возникает при попытке отобразить на странице данные из пустого набора записей.

Одним из распространенных сообщений об ошибке, которое может появиться во время тестирования подключения базы данных PHP к MySQL 4. Может понадобиться вернуться к более ранней версии MySQL или установить PHP 5 и скопировать некоторые динамически связываемые библиотеки DLL.

При выборе другого региона изменится язык и контент сайта Adobe. Dreamweaver Обучение и поддержка Руководство для начинающих Руководство пользователя Руководства Бесплатная пробная версия Купить сейчас. Устранение неполадок подключений к базам данных Поиск. На этой странице Устранение проблем с разрешениями Устранение неполадок, связанных с сообщениями об ошибках в продуктах Майкрософт Устранение неполадок, связанных с сообщениями об ошибках MySQL.

Устранение проблем с разрешениями, сообщения об ошибках в продуктах Майкрософт и MySQL в Dreamweaver. Устранение проблем с разрешениями. Проверка или изменение разрешений для файла базы данных в Windows XP. Для изменения разрешений необходимо иметь права администратора на соответствующем компьютере. В диалоговом окне отобразятся дополнительные параметры.

Проверка или изменение разрешений для файла базы данных в Windows Устранение неполадок, связанных с сообщениями об ошибках в продуктах Майкрософт. Если проблемы так и не удалось решить, см. Далее перечислены возможные решения. Данная ошибка возникает, когда событие обновляет набор записей или вставляет в него данные. Далее перечислены возможные причины и способы решения. В имени использованы специальные символы. Вот несколько примеров специальных символов: Выделите динамическое содержимое на странице. Повторите шаги 1—3 для каждого элемента динамического содержимого на странице. Устранение неполадок, связанных с сообщениями об ошибках MySQL.

Вопросы сообществу Получайте помощь от экспертов по интересующим вас вопросам. Свяжитесь с нами Реальная помощь от реальных людей. Отправить Комментариев нет Нажимая кнопку "Отправить", вы принимаете Условия использования Adobe. Выберите регион При выборе другого региона изменится язык и контент сайта Adobe.

Рубрика: Driver

на «»

Copyright © 2009. All Rights Reserved.